The Calcium Silicate Hydrate (CSH) family mineral such as Xonotlite (X), Tobermorite (T) was synthesized by hydrothermal method using rice hush and CaO as the Si and Ca supplier. The rice hush (RH) was burnt inside the furnace at 500oC for 2hrs to obtain the rice hush ash (RHA), then mixing with CaO with the Ca/Si 1.0, and hydrothermal treatment at 110oC for 24h to obtain Xonotlite and Tobermorite mineral with micropore structure (coded as CSH-110/24). The CSH 110/24 samples were used to remove Chrome (III) in 2,4 and 6 hours, with fast removal phenomena. This research can be applied in metallurgy industry such as removal Chrome (III) during the Chrome-coating process.
